Head and Neck Cancer

Head and neck cancer refers to a type of cancer that arises in the head or neck region of the body. This can occur in the mouth, throat, nose, sinuses, or salivary glands. The most common risk factors associated with head and neck cancer are tobacco use and excessive alcohol consumption. Other risk factors include exposure to human papillomavirus (HPV) and poor oral hygiene. Symptoms of head and neck cancer can include difficulty swallowing, persistent headaches, ear pain, and noticeable swelling or lumps in the neck or throat. Treatment typically involves a combination of surgery, radiation therapy, and chemotherapy. Early detection and treatment can significantly improve prognosis and quality of life.

Symptoms of Head and Neck Cancer

What are the common signs of head and neck cancer?

Common signs of head and neck cancer include a sore throat, difficulty swallowing, a lump or swelling in the neck, changes in the voice or hoarseness, persistent ear pain or ringing, and coughing up blood. These symptoms can be caused by other conditions, so it is important to consult a doctor if they persist.

What lifestyle factors can increase the risk of developing head and neck cancer?

Lifestyle factors that can increase the risk of developing head and neck cancer include smoking and tobacco use, excessive alcohol consumption, poor diet, and exposure to certain chemicals and toxins. HPV infection and a weakened immune system can also increase the risk.

What role does Human papillomavirus (HPV) play in head and neck cancer?

HPV is a risk factor for oropharyngeal cancer, which is a type of head and neck cancer that affects the back of the throat, including the base of the tongue and tonsils. It is estimated that HPV causes up to 70% of oropharyngeal cancers. Vaccination against HPV can help reduce the risk of developing this cancer.

How does excessive alcohol consumption contribute to head and neck cancer development?

Excessive alcohol consumption can increase the risk of head and neck cancer by damaging cells in the lining of the mouth, throat, and esophagus. It can also make it easier for carcinogens to enter cells and damage DNA. Drinking alcohol in combination with smoking or tobacco use can further increase the risk.

Can exposure to certain chemicals and toxins increase the risk of head and neck cancer?

Exposure to certain chemicals and toxins, such as asbestos, wood dust, and paint fumes, can increase the risk of developing head and neck cancer. People who work in certain industries, such as construction and manufacturing, may be at higher risk due to exposure to these substances. Protective measures such as wearing masks and proper ventilation can help reduce the risk.

Diagnosis of Head and Neck Cancer

What diagnostic tests are typically used in the diagnosis of head and neck cancer?

Diagnostic tests used in the diagnosis of head and neck cancer include physical examination, biopsy, endoscopy, imaging tests, and laboratory tests. Physical examination involves a thorough assessment of the mouth, throat, and neck area. Biopsy is performed by taking a tissue sample from the suspected cancerous area which is then examined under a microscope. Endoscopy involves inserting a thin, flexible tube with a camera and light into the mouth or nose to examine the inside of the throat and nearby areas. Imaging tests include X-rays, CT scans, MRI, PET scans, and ultrasound, which can help to determine the size and location of the tumor. Laboratory tests may be conducted to check for certain biomarkers or genetic markers that may be linked to the development of cancer.

How is a biopsy performed to confirm a diagnosis of head and neck cancer?

A biopsy is typically performed under local anesthesia, and the procedure involves taking a small piece of tissue from the suspected cancerous area. The tissue is then examined under a microscope to determine if it is cancerous. The procedure may involve using a needle to obtain the tissue sample (needle biopsy), or it may involve surgically removing a piece of tissue (excisional biopsy). The pathologist examines the tissue sample and provides a diagnosis.

What imaging modalities are commonly used in the diagnosis of head and neck cancer?

Imaging modalities commonly used in the diagnosis of head and neck cancer include X-rays, CT scans, MRI, PET scans, and ultrasound. X-rays are often used to detect bone abnormalities, while CT scans and MRI are used to obtain detailed images of the head and neck area. PET scans are used to detect changes in metabolic activity, which can indicate the presence of cancer. Ultrasound is used to evaluate the thyroid gland and lymph nodes.

What are some early signs and symptoms of head and neck cancer that may prompt diagnostic testing?

Early signs and symptoms of head and neck cancer can include a sore throat, difficulty swallowing, hoarseness, a lump or sore that does not heal, changes in voice or speech, ear pain or ringing, a persistent cough, and difficulty breathing. Other symptoms can include weight loss, fatigue, and difficulty opening the mouth. These symptoms may prompt diagnostic testing to determine if cancer is present.

Are there any specific blood tests or biomarkers that can aid in the diagnosis of head and neck cancer?

There are specific blood tests and biomarkers that can aid in the diagnosis of head and neck cancer, including circulating tumor cells (CTCs), cell-free DNA (cfDNA), and microRNAs. These tests are not typically used as a screening tool but may be used to monitor the progression of the disease or to evaluate treatment response in certain cases. However, these tests are not yet widely available, and further research is needed to determine their clinical utility.

Treatments of Head and Neck Cancer

What are the common treatment options for head and neck cancer?

Common treatment options for head and neck cancer include surgery, radiation therapy, chemotherapy, and targeted therapy. Surgery involves the removal of the cancerous tissue, and it may be used alone or in combination with other therapies. Radiation therapy uses high-energy radiation to kill cancer cells, shrink tumors, and relieve symptoms. Chemotherapy may be used alongside radiation therapy or surgery, and it involves the use of drugs to kill cancer cells. Targeted therapy uses drugs that target specific molecules in cancer cells to inhibit their growth and spread.

How important is early detection in the management of head and neck cancer?

Early detection is crucial in the management of head and neck cancer because it increases the chances of successful treatment outcomes. Early symptoms may include a lump or sore in the neck or mouth, difficulty swallowing or speaking, ear pain, and persistent cough. Routine screening for head and neck cancer is recommended, especially for individuals who have a history of tobacco or alcohol use, and those with a family history of the disease.

Can chemotherapy be used as a standalone therapy for head and neck cancer?

Chemotherapy may be used as a standalone therapy for head and neck cancer, but it is often used in combination with other treatments. The use of chemotherapy alone depends on the stage and type of cancer, as well as the patient`s overall health. However, chemotherapy may cause side effects such as hair loss, nausea, vomiting, and weakened immune system.

What are the potential side effects of radiation therapy for head and neck cancer?

Potential side effects of radiation therapy for head and neck cancer may include dry mouth, difficulty swallowing, changes in taste, and skin irritation. These side effects are usually temporary and can be managed with medication and lifestyle changes. However, radiation therapy may also cause long-term side effects such as dental problems and secondary cancers.

Is immunotherapy a viable treatment option for head and neck cancer patients?

Immunotherapy is emerging as a viable treatment option for head and neck cancer patients. It works by boosting the patient`s immune system to recognize and attack cancer cells. Immune checkpoint inhibitors and adoptive cell transfer therapy are two examples of immunotherapy used in the treatment of head and neck cancer. However, not all patients may respond to immunotherapy, and it may cause side effects such as fatigue, rash, and digestive issues.

Prognosis of Head and Neck Cancer

What is the survival rate for individuals diagnosed with head and neck cancer?

According to the American Cancer Society, the overall 5-year survival rate for individuals diagnosed with head and neck cancer is approximately 65%. However, survival rates can vary widely depending on factors such as the stage of the cancer and the specific location of the tumor.

How does the stage of head and neck cancer affect the prognosis?

The stage of head and neck cancer can have a significant impact on the prognosis. In general, individuals with early-stage cancer (stages I and II) have a better chance of survival than those with advanced-stage cancer (stages III and IV). Additionally, the stage of the cancer can affect the recommended treatment options, as well as the potential side effects and complications of treatment.

Can the location of the tumor affect the prognosis of head and neck cancer patients?

Yes, the location of the tumor can affect the prognosis of head and neck cancer patients. For example, tumors located in the oral cavity or oropharynx tend to have a better prognosis than those located in the nasopharynx or hypopharynx. The location of the tumor can also affect the treatment options and potential side effects.

What are some prognostic factors that are commonly used to determine the outcome of head and neck cancer?

There are several prognostic factors that are commonly used to determine the outcome of head and neck cancer, including the stage of the cancer, the location and size of the tumor, whether or not the cancer has spread to nearby lymph nodes or other parts of the body, the individual`s age and overall health, and the type of cancer (e.g. squamous cell carcinoma, salivary gland cancer, etc.). Other factors, such as whether the individual smokes or drinks alcohol, can also impact the prognosis.

Is the recurrence rate of head and neck cancer typically higher or lower than other types of cancer?

The recurrence rate of head and neck cancer can vary depending on the stage of the cancer and the specific treatment approach used. However, in general, the recurrence rate for head and neck cancer is higher than for some other types of cancer. According to a study published in the Journal of Clinical Oncology, the 5-year recurrence-free survival rate for individuals with early-stage head and neck cancer is approximately 80%, while the rate for those with advanced-stage cancer is closer to 50%. It is important for individuals with head and neck cancer to receive appropriate follow-up care and screening to help detect and manage any recurrence.

Prevention of Head and Neck Cancer

What are the most effective ways to prevent head and neck cancer?

The most effective ways to prevent head and neck cancer include adopting a healthy lifestyle, avoiding risk factors, and getting the Human Papillomavirus (HPV) vaccine. Some healthy lifestyle habits that can help prevent head and neck cancer include maintaining a healthy weight, eating a balanced diet rich in vegetables and fruits, limiting alcohol intake, not smoking or using tobacco products, and protecting yourself from the sun. It is also important to practice safe sex, as some sexually transmitted infections can increase the risk of developing head and neck cancer.

How often should individuals undergo screening for head and neck cancer?

Currently, there are no widely accepted screening recommendations for head and neck cancer in the general population. However, individuals who have a history of smoking tobacco, consuming alcohol, or exposure to HPV may benefit from regular screenings. A healthcare provider can help determine an appropriate screening schedule based on individual risk factors and medical history.

Which lifestyle habits increase the risk of developing head and neck cancer, and how can they be minimized?

Lifestyle habits such as tobacco use, excessive alcohol consumption, and poor diet can increase the risk of developing head and neck cancer. To minimize these risks, individuals should avoid tobacco products, limit alcohol intake, eat a healthy diet rich in fruits and vegetables, and maintain a healthy weight. It is also important to practice safe sex and avoid exposure to certain chemicals and toxins, such as asbestos and wood dust.

What role does vaccination play in preventing head and neck cancer?

The HPV vaccine can prevent certain types of head and neck cancer. HPV is a common virus that can be spread through sexual contact and is known to cause several types of cancer, including some types of head and neck cancer. The HPV vaccine is recommended for both males and females, ideally before becoming sexually active. It is most effective when administered at a young age, but can also be given up to age 26.

Are there any specific dietary recommendations for reducing the risk of head and neck cancer?

While there are no specific dietary recommendations for reducing the risk of head and neck cancer, a healthy diet that includes a variety of fruits and vegetables, whole grains, lean protein, and healthy fats can help boost overall health and potentially reduce cancer risk. Eating a diet rich in antioxidants and avoiding processed or highly-salted foods can also be beneficial. However, it is important to note that maintaining a healthy diet alone cannot guarantee the prevention of head and neck cancer.
